Recognizing the Different Kinds Of Windows and Their Prices



When you're considering home window replacement, it's essential to understand the different kinds offered and their associated expenses.

You'll run into alternatives like double-hung, sash, sliding, and bay windows, each supplying unique appearances and functionality.

Double-hung home windows are prominent for their timeless appearance and flexibility, normally varying from $300 to $800 per home window.

Casement home windows, which open outward, give exceptional air flow and have a tendency to cost between $400 and $1,000.

Sliding home windows are simple to operate and generally fall in the $300 to $700 array.

Bay windows, known for their spacious appearance, can be pricier, beginning around $1,000 and going up.

Malfunction of Labor Expenditures and Added Costs



Selecting the right home windows is just the beginning; you also require to consider labor expenses and added costs associated with setup.

Generally, labor costs can range from $40 to $100 per hour, depending upon your location and the contractor's experience. replacing old crank out windows will certainly take a few hours to a number of days, so you must calculate as necessary.

In addition, be aware of extra expenses that might develop, like removal of old windows, disposal costs, or repair work required for your home's structure.

If you're considering custom windows, there may be design charges as well. Tips for Developing a Realistic Allocate Home Window Replacement



Creating a realistic allocate window replacement calls for careful preparation and consideration of all prospective costs.

Start by investigating the typical costs of products and labor in your location. Get numerous quotes from professionals to contrast rates and services.

Do not neglect to factor in extra costs like authorizations, disposal costs, and any kind of needed fixings to your home. Reserve a contingency fund, ideally 10-20% of your complete budget plan, to cover any type of unanticipated expenditures that might occur.





Focus on energy-efficient home windows, as they can save you money in the future via lower utility bills.

Last but not least, think about whether you'll DIY any facets to reduce labor prices, but be sensible regarding your abilities and time.
